Summary:Abstract: "This paper deals with a delayed column generation approach for the linear programming (LP) relaxation of NP-hard multiple- depot vehicle scheduling problems in public mass transit. We present new delayed column generation techniques, which are based on two different Lagrangean relaxation approaches, and describe in detail all basic ingredients of our approach that are indispensable to solve truely large- scale problem instances. The computational investigations are based on real-world test sets from the cities of Berlin and Hamburg having up to 25 thousand timetabled trips and 70 million dead-head trips."
